F10
Bauknecht Water inlet valve / fill circuit fault

Washer does not fill with water, F10 displayed shortly after start

Possible Causes

Closed or low-pressure water supply, clogged inlet filter screens, faulty water inlet valve coil, wiring fault to inlet valve

How to Fix / Troubleshooting

Safety first: Turn off water supply and unplug the washer.

  • Check water supply: Ensure the tap feeding the washer is fully open and that household water pressure is adequate. Test by filling a bucket from the same tap.
  • Clean inlet filters: Disconnect the inlet hose from the back of the washer. Inside the valve connection are small mesh filters. Gently pull them out with pliers and rinse under running water to remove limescale and debris.
  • Inspect inlet hose: Check for kinks or internal blockages. Replace if damaged.
  • Valve coil check (for experienced users): With power disconnected, measure resistance across the valve coils. Open-circuit coils indicate a failed valve that must be replaced.

If F10 persists with good water supply: Replace the water inlet valve assembly. If still unresolved, the control board output to the valve may be faulty.
